Weidmüller 1503660000 Terminal Block Plug –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The Weidmüller 1503660000 is a 20-position terminal block plug with female sockets, 0.200" (5.08mm) pitch, and 180° free-hanging (in-line) mounting. This component is part of the Omnimate BL series and is classified as obsolete. Due to its discontinued status, equivalent substitute parts from active manufacturers are necessary to maintain system compatibility and ensure long-term supply chain reliability.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itute parts for the Weidmüller 1503660000 are identified based on the following critical parameters that determine functional compatibility:

Primary Matching Criteria:

  • 20-position configuration
  • Female socket type
  • Pitch tolerance (0.200" / 5.08mm or 0.197" / 5.00mm)
  • Free-hanging (in-line) mounting
  • Screw termination style
  • UL94 V-0 flammability rating
  • Tin contact mating finish

Secondary Considerations:

  • Wire gauge compatibility (12-30 AWG range acceptable)
  • Voltage and current ratings (UL 300V / 15A minimum)
  • Retention latch configuration
  • Product status (active preferred for obsolete parts)

The substitute parts listed below meet these criteria with variations in wire entry angle (90°, 180°, 270°), housing material, and screw clamp mechanism (rising cage clamp vs. top clamp). These variations allow for direct functional substitution in applications where the specific wire entry orientation and clamp style are compatible with the system design.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

Direct Replacement (180° Wire Entry):

For applications requiring the same 180° wire entry orientation as the original Weidmüller 1503660000, the Phoenix Contact 1757190 is the primary active substitute. Both parts share identical pitch (0.200" / 5.08mm) and wire entry angle. The Phoenix Contact part offers higher current capacity (15A UL vs. 10A UL) and superior voltage rating (630V IEC vs. 400V IEC), making it suitable for equivalent or more demanding applications. The rising cage clamp termination provides equivalent screw-based connection reliability.

Alternative Orientations (90° or 270° Wire Entry):

When system layout permits alternative wire entry angles, the Amphenol PCD ELFF series (ELFF20230 for 90°, ELFF20240 for 270°) offers active product status with 0.200" (5.08mm) pitch matching. These parts maintain full electrical compatibility (15A UL, 300V UL) and UL94 V-0 flammability compliance. The ELFF series uses polyphenylene oxide (PPO) housing, which differs from the original PBT material but meets the same flammability standard.

Pitch Tolerance Consideration:

The Amphenol PCD ELFF20130 and ELFF20140 operate at 0.197" (5.00mm) pitch, representing a 0.03mm deviation from the original 0.200" (5.08mm) specification. These parts are suitable only when mechanical tolerance analysis confirms compatibility with the mating connector or header.

Compliance and Supply Chain:

All substitute parts carry active product status and RoHS compliance certification, ensuring long-term availability and regulatory alignment. The Weidmüller 1503660000 obsolete status necessitates transition to one of these active alternatives for new designs or system maintenance requiring component replenishment.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the Phoenix Contact 1757190 directly replace the Weidmüller 1503660000?

A: Yes, for applications where 180° wire entry is required. Both parts share 0.200" (5.08mm) pitch, 20-position configuration, and female socket type. The Phoenix Contact part has higher electrical ratings (15A UL, 630V IEC) and uses a rising cage clamp instead of a top clamp, but both are screw-based termination methods suitable for equivalent connection reliability.

Q: What is the difference between the Amphenol ELFF20230 and ELFF20240?

A: Both parts are identical except for wire entry angle. ELFF20230 has 90° wire entry, while ELFF20240 has 270° wire entry. Both use 0.200" (5.08mm) pitch and are suitable substitutes when the system layout accommodates these alternative orientations.

Q: Are the Amphenol ELFF20130 and ELFF20140 compatible with the original Weidmüller part?

A: These parts have 0.197" (5.00mm) pitch instead of 0.200" (5.08mm). Compatibility depends on mechanical tolerance analysis of the mating connector or header. The 0.03mm pitch difference may be acceptable in some applications but requires verification before implementation.

Q: Why do substitute parts have different housing materials?

A: The Phoenix Contact 1757190 uses polyamide (PA) nylon, while Amphenol ELFF series uses polyphenylene oxide (PPO). The Weidmüller original uses PBT glass-filled plastic. All materials meet UL94 V-0 flammability requirements. Material selection affects thermal performance and chemical resistance; verify compatibility with the operating environment.

Q: Do all substitute parts support the same wire gauge range?

A: The original Weidmüller part accepts 14-26 AWG (0.2-2.5mm²). All substitute parts accept 12-30 AWG or 12 AWG plus 14-26 AWG, providing equal or broader wire gauge compatibility. Verify that the specific wire gauge used in your application falls within the acceptable range for your selected substitute.

Q: What is the difference between TOP clamp and rising cage clamp termination?

A: Both are screw-based termination methods. TOP clamp (original Weidmüller) secures the wire from above, while rising cage clamp (all substitutes) uses a cage mechanism that rises as the screw tightens. Both methods provide secure electrical connection; the choice depends on system design and assembly procedure compatibility.

Q: Are all substitute parts RoHS compliant?

A: Yes. The Phoenix Contact 1757190 is ROHS3 compliant, and all Amphenol ELFF series parts are RoHS compliant. The original Weidmüller part does not specify RoHS status. For new designs or systems requiring RoHS certification, all listed substitutes meet this requirement.
